Francesca DerosaShareKnown For (Movies)48%Pirate's Code: The Adventures of Mickey Matson52%The Adventures of Mickey Matson and the Copperhead ConspiracyPrevious slideNext slideKnown For (TV)72%Without a TracePrevious slideNext slide